T82.03 ICD 2026 Code: Leakage of heart valve prosthesis

T82.03 is the authoritative medical code for Leakage of heart valve prosthesis. This classification is used in medical billing and clinical recording to specify the clinical criteria for leakage of heart valve prosthesis (ICD-10-CM T82.03), ensuring healthcare documentation aligns with 2026 federal coding standards.

Billing Status: NO. This is a clinician non-billable / parent hierarchy grouping in the ICD-10-CM system.

Official Registry Overview & Definition

Leakage of heart valve prosthesis is a non-billable ICD-10-CM category code T82.03. A more specific billable subcode must be selected for claims submission. Excludes1 (not coded here): mechanical complication of biological heart valve graft T82.22-. Excludes2 (not included here): failure and rejection of transplanted organs and tissue T86.-; any encounters with medical care for postprocedural conditions in which no complications are present, such as:; artificial opening status Z93.-; closure of external stoma Z43.-; fitting and adjustment of external prosthetic device Z44.-; burns and corrosions from local applications and irradiation T20-T32; complications of surgical procedures during pregnancy, childbirth and the puerperium O00-O9A; mechanical complication of respirator ventilator; poisoning and toxic effects of drugs and chemicals (T36-T65 with fifth or sixth character 1-4 or 6); postprocedural fever R50.82; specified complications classified elsewhere, such as:; cerebrospinal fluid leak from spinal puncture G97.0; colostomy malfunction K94.0-; disorders of fluid and electrolyte imbalance E86-E87; functional disturbances following cardiac surgery I97.0-I97.1; intraoperative and postprocedural complications of specified body systems (D78.-, E36.-, E89.-, G97.3-, G97.4, H59.3-, H59.-, H95.2-, H95.3, I97.4-, I97.5, J95.6-, J95.7, K91.6-, L76.-, M96.-, N99.-); ostomy complications (J95.0-, K94.-, N99.5-); postgastric surgery syndromes K91.1; postlaminectomy syndrome NEC M96.1; postmastectomy lymphedema syndrome I97.2; postsurgical blind-loop syndrome K91.2; ventilator associated pneumonia J95.851. 7th character: The appropriate 7th character is to be added to each code from category T82.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) & Clinical Guidance

Can T82.03 be billed directly?

No. T82.03 (Leakage of heart valve prosthesis) is a non-billable ICD-10-CM category code. A more specific billable subcode must be selected based on clinical documentation.

Does T82.03 require a 7th character?

Yes. The appropriate 7th character is to be added to each code from category T82.

What can't be coded together with T82.03?

Per Excludes1 instructions, T82.03 must not be reported with: mechanical complication of biological heart valve graft (T82.22-).

Can T82.03 be reported alongside related conditions?

Per Excludes2 instructions, T82.03 and the following may both be reported when both are present: failure and rejection of transplanted organs and tissue (T86.-); any encounters with medical care for postprocedural conditions in which no complications are present, such as:; artificial opening status (Z93.-); closure of external stoma (Z43.-).
